Average rent in Knoxville, Tennessee

The average rent for a 1 bedroom apartment in Knoxville is $1,413+, while the average rent for a 2 bedroom apartment is $1,775+. Rent rates updated 5 days ago
Studio
$1,217+
Prices trending down
1 Bed
$1,413+
Prices trending down
2 Beds
$1,775+
Prices trending down
3+ Beds
$2,135+
Prices trending down
* Averages are based on the rental prices of properties listed on Apartment List that don’t include fees

  • Map of Downtown Knoxville

    Downtown Knoxville

    What's it like to live in Downtown Knoxville?

    Southern charm meets urban renewal in Downtown Knoxville, where historic buildings now house unique apartments with architectural details from the city's prosperous past. The walkable district centers around Market Square with its outdoor concerts, farmers markets, and dining options ranging from casual to sophisticated. Many buildings feature rooftop decks showcasing views of the Tennessee River and Smoky Mountains on the horizon. Some buildings lack dedicated parking requiring separate garage rentals, and weekend events can create noise that carries through historic buildings with limited soundproofing. Particularly appealing to young professionals and empty nesters who value walkable amenities and urban energy while appreciating the more manageable scale of Knoxville compared to larger southeastern cities.

  • Map of Inskip

    Inskip

    What's it like to live in Inskip?

    First-time homebuyers priced out of trendier districts are discovering rental values in Inskip, where mid-century ranch homes offer significantly more space than downtown Knoxville options. The neighborhood's proximity to both I-640 and I-75 creates quick access to major employment centers without lengthy commutes affecting quality of life. Unlike newer subdivisions with their cookie-cutter aesthetics, these properties feature established landscaping with mature trees providing natural shade during Tennessee's hot summers. The nearby Fountain City Park offers recreation facilities including duck ponds and playground equipment perfect for weekend activities without extensive planning. When considering rental options, properties on Woodland Avenue provide slightly better access to shopping and dining – a distinction worth noting for those seeking maximum convenience within this emerging North Knoxville community.

  • Map of Fountain City

    Fountain City

    What's it like to live in Fountain City?

    Historic charm permeates Fountain City, where 1920s bungalows surrounding Fountain City Park's iconic duck pond create a small-town atmosphere within Knoxville's boundaries. Original plaster walls develop characteristic cracks during summer humidity spikes, requiring regular maintenance and dehumidifiers during the wettest months. The Central Avenue commercial district provides neighborhood essentials, including a beloved pie shop with limited but devoted following. Many properties feature distinctive front porches that foster community connections through impromptu evening gatherings, particularly during firefly season.

Knoxville Renter Confidence Survey

National study of renter’s satisfaction with their cities and states

Here’s how Knoxville ranks on:


Overview of Findings

Apartment List has released Knoxville’s results from the third annual Apartment List Renter Satisfaction Survey. This survey, which drew on responses from over 45,000 renters, provides insight on what states and cities must do to meet the needs of 111 million American renters nationwide.

"Knoxville renters expressed general satisfaction with the city overall," according to Apartment List. "Some categories received above average scores, and many received average scores."

Key findings in Knoxville include the following:

  • Knoxville renters gave their city a B- overall.
  • The highest-rated categories for Knoxville were affordability (A+), weather (A) and jobs and career opportunities (A).
  • The areas of concern to Knoxville renters are recreational activities (C+) and public transit (C).
  • Knoxville did relatively poorly compared to other Tennessee cities like Nashville (A-) but relatively well compared to Memphis (C).
  • Knoxville did relatively well compared to other cities nationwide, including Miami, FL (C+), New York, NY (C+) and Los Angeles, CA (C+).
  • The top rated cities nationwide for renter satisfaction include Scottsdale, AZ, Irvine, CA, Boulder, CO and Ann Arbor, MI. The lowest rated cities include Tallahassee, FL, Stockton, CA, Dayton, OH, Detroit, MI and Newark, NJ.

Renters say:

  • "Overall I love it, but it’s very spread out and that can make it hard to enjoy everything." – Hayley H.
  • "I love the proximity to outdoor activities. There’s lots to do and the growing coffee and craft brewery scene is great. But traffic can be surprisingly bad for such a small town, especially where the three highways meet." – Jill B.
  • "Love that people are friendly and there are lots of places to eat. But I hate that jobs seem to be low-income and traffic can be bad." – Frank J.
  • "Love the mountains and trails being so close. Tons of nature parks. But I hate that the sales taxes are so high." – Samantha H.
